World War II Combat Zone 34°23′40″N 132°27′20″E  /  34.39438°N 132.45547°E  / 34.39438; 132.45547  ( World War II Combat WebThe world's first nuclear explosion occurred on July 16, 1945, when a plutonium implosion device was tested at a site located 210 miles south of Los Alamos, New Mexico, on the plains of the Alamogordo Bombing Range, known as the Jornada del Muerto. The code name for the test was "Trinity." The area is remote, which is just what officials were looking for when choosing an area to test the weapon. At the time of selection there was only a small farm, which contained a house and several buildings. The farm sat about two miles southeast of the eventual detonation site and was acquired by the U.S. government in 1942. mane street horse and pet waxhaw
